What is NASA's Internet speed?

What is the highest speed of internet in NASA? The internet speed of NASA is exceptionally high thanks to the kinds of data they deal with. Their networks are capable of 91 gigabits per second, as they found out from an experiment they did in 2013. But it does not mean that their entire network is that fast.

Is Japan using 6G?

DOCOMO and NTT plan to start indoor 6G trials this fiscal year, which ends March 2023, and outdoor trials next year. The work of the three equipment vendors will be divided as shown in the chart. Nokia will provide the 6G AI-native air interface (the access mode or link between two stations in wireless communications).

Is America using 6G?

As for the U.S., the 6G effort is more private than government-fueled, although the federal government did announce a partnership with South Korea over 6G research in 2021. Some mobile companies in America are progressing with their own 6G development.

Can 5G pass through walls?

4G wavelengths have a range of about 10 miles, whereas 5G has a range of just 1,000 feet. Due to this, 5G signals can be blocked by physical barriers like walls and glass. Difficulty moving from outdoors to indoors can result in poor coverage and slower download speeds.

Is 5G better than 4G?

The biggest difference between 4G and 5G is latency. 5G promises low latency under 5 milliseconds, while 4G latency ranges from 60 ms to 98 ms. In addition, with lower latency comes advancements in other areas, such as faster download speeds. Potential download speeds.

How do I get NASA WIFI?

To access the NASA BYOD Wireless Network:
  1. Select the "nasabyod" wireless network from your personal devices's list of available networks.
  2. When prompted, enter your NDC User ID and Password.
  3. To access internal sites, you will need to connect to JSC's Virtual Private Network (VPN)

Is 1tb internet speed possible?

Researchers at the University of Surrey in England have achieved 5G speeds of 1 Terabit per second (Tbps) over 100 metres in the lab - by far the fastest wireless connection to date.

How fast is spacex internet?

Starlink's median download speed of 155.15 Mbps during Q4 2021 was much faster than the country's median download for all fixed broadband of 76.94 Mbps. That's also a large increase from Starlink's median download speed of 127.46 Mbps in Q3 2021.
